Ingredients
- 4 cups mini marshmallows
- 3/4 cup milk
- 3 oz. bittersweet baking chocolate, chopped fine
- 3/4 cup heavy cream, chilled
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Directions
- Cook the marshmallows, milk, and chocolate in a medium saucepan over low heat, whisking constantly, until melted and smooth, about 4 minutes.
- Transfer the mixture to a medium bowl and set in a larger bowl of ice water. Let stand, whisking often, until cool and thickened, 15 to 20 minutes.
- Whip the cream and vanilla with an electric mixer on low speed until frothy, about 1 minute. Increase to high speed and continue to whip until soft peaks form, 1 to 3 minutes.
- Fold the whipped cream into the chocolate mixture, leaving just a few streaks. Spoon into wine glasses or goblets, cover with plastic wrap, and refrigerate until set before serving, about 6 hours.
